A museum full of animals, but there's a catch--they are all preserved by taxidermy. With dioramas and other displays, there is no concern about how the animals are treated or fed. It is a great place for kids especially to see up close and touch many wild animals without fear.

Ok, so to be honest, this is not one of my family's favorites, but it is a popular Tucson destination so I wanted to include it. Some people can make a day out of it, and read in-depth about the various animals. However, be warned that it is a museum of taxidermy animals. My son (and I, to be honest) find it a little weird staring at room after room of stuffed animals. We usually made it through in an hour. If you are visiting from out of state, and have a membership to a museum that is part of the ASTC, you can double check to see if you can get free admission.
